กระทู้เก่าบอร์ด อ.Yeadram
        
           3,473   7		  
          
					  
		    URL.หัวข้อ / 
		    URL
        
        Export file ไปที่ Excel วันที่เปลี่ยน      
    
      รบกวนท่านอาจารย์และผู้รู้ทุกท่านด้วยครับ พอดีผมส่งไฟล์ไปลง Excel แล้ววันที่มันเป็นตัวสี่เหลี่ยมหมดเลย มีวิธีแก้ไขแบบไหนครับ ตามรูปเลยครับ
 
    
    
   
    
				7 Reply in this Topic. Dispaly 1  pages and you are on page number 1 
				
        
    1 @R05159    
        
  
      ฟิลด์ที่เก็บวันที่เหล่านี้ในฐานข้อมูลของ Access เป็นฟิลด์ที่มีประเภทข้อมูลเป็นอะไร (เช่น Text, Date/Time, ...) และลองเลือกช่องที่เป็น # ใน Excel แล้วคลิกขวาเพื่อแปลงให้เป็นข้อมูลประเภทวันที่ ลองดูว่าได้หรือไม่    
    
  
        
    2 @R05161    
        
  
      ลองขยายคอลั่มนั้นให้มันกว้างไปอีกสักหน่อยค่ะ    
    
  
        
    3 @R05163    
        
  
      ขอบคุณสำหรับทุกคำตอบครับ ผมได้เช็คที่ฟิลด์แล้ว ประเภทข้อมูลเป็น (Date/Time) ครับ ตามรูปแนบครับ 
 
แต่มีหลายเขตข้อมูลที่ฟิลด์เป็นประเภท Date/Time แต่ว่าใช้ได้ไม่มีปัญหาครับ มีแค่ 2 คอลัมภ์เองครับ ที่เป็นปัญหา
และที่ Excel เองผมเลือกทุกฟอรแมทแล้ว ก็ยังเหมือนเดิมครับ รวมทั้งขยายคอลัมภ์ด้วยครับ ผมอยากจะลองใช้สูตรบน Excel เพื่อแปลงเป็นวันที่ แต่ยังนึกไม่ออกว่าจะใช้ฟังชันต์ตัวไหนดี ช่วยแนะนำด้วยน่ะครับ
ขอบคุณครับ
    
   
แต่มีหลายเขตข้อมูลที่ฟิลด์เป็นประเภท Date/Time แต่ว่าใช้ได้ไม่มีปัญหาครับ มีแค่ 2 คอลัมภ์เองครับ ที่เป็นปัญหา
และที่ Excel เองผมเลือกทุกฟอรแมทแล้ว ก็ยังเหมือนเดิมครับ รวมทั้งขยายคอลัมภ์ด้วยครับ ผมอยากจะลองใช้สูตรบน Excel เพื่อแปลงเป็นวันที่ แต่ยังนึกไม่ออกว่าจะใช้ฟังชันต์ตัวไหนดี ช่วยแนะนำด้วยน่ะครับ
ขอบคุณครับ
        
    4 @R05165    
        
  
      ผมลองที่เครื่องผม แม้เป็นตัวเลขมันก็ยังเป็นค่าบวกนะครับ สงสัยว่าในเซลที่มีค่าเป็น -158395 นั้น ตรงกับวันที่ที่มีค่าเป็นอะไรในฐานข้อมูลครับ ถ้ามีทั้ง เวลาและนาที ด้วยก็บอกมาด้วยนะครับ จะลองดูว่าถ้าเป็นเครื่องผมมันจะให้วันที่นั้นออกมาเป็นค่าลบหรือไม่    
    
  
        
    5 @R05168    
        
  
      ผมลองไปเปิดที่เครื่องอื่น การแสดงวันที่เป็นปกติครับ ( 03/03/2010) แต่เวลาที่เปิดที่เครื่องผมเอง กลับเป็นว่าตามรูปแนบครับ
 
ส่งผลถึงการ export file ไปลงที่ excel ด้วย ผมลองเทียบค่าการตั้งเรื่องวันที่กับเครื่องอื่นก็ปกติดีครับ
 
อีกอย่างที่ผมสงสัย เพราะว่าอีกส่วนหนึ่งที่ลง ผมคิดว่าเขาลงข้อมูลที่ Excel ก่อนแล้วค่อยก๊อปปี้มาลงที่ Access ทีหลัง
ที่ฐานข้อมูลทุกฟลิด์ที่เป็นวันที่ ผมเช็คเหมือนกันหมดครับ แต่ฟิลด์อื่นก็แสดงวันที่ปกติ นอกเสียจากเหตุผลข้างต้นที่ผมยกมาครับ
ขอบคุณครับ
    
   
ส่งผลถึงการ export file ไปลงที่ excel ด้วย ผมลองเทียบค่าการตั้งเรื่องวันที่กับเครื่องอื่นก็ปกติดีครับ
 
อีกอย่างที่ผมสงสัย เพราะว่าอีกส่วนหนึ่งที่ลง ผมคิดว่าเขาลงข้อมูลที่ Excel ก่อนแล้วค่อยก๊อปปี้มาลงที่ Access ทีหลัง
ที่ฐานข้อมูลทุกฟลิด์ที่เป็นวันที่ ผมเช็คเหมือนกันหมดครับ แต่ฟิลด์อื่นก็แสดงวันที่ปกติ นอกเสียจากเหตุผลข้างต้นที่ผมยกมาครับ
ขอบคุณครับ
        
    6 @R05169    
        
       
รูปที่แสดงบน Access ครับ
วันที่เพี้ยนๆยังไงไม่รู่ครับ
    
  
   
รูปที่แสดงบน Access ครับ
วันที่เพี้ยนๆยังไงไม่รู่ครับ
        
    7 @R05170    
        
    
      ผมลองป้อนที่เครื่องผมดูเป็น ค.ศ. 1466 แล้วexportไป Excel ก็จะได้เป็นค่าลบและแสดงเป็นเครื่อง # เหมือนของคุณนั่นแหล่ะ
ให้ลอง Compact and Repair Database ถ้าคุณแยกไฟล์โปรแกรมและฐานข้อมูลออกจากกัน ก็ให้ทำทั้ง 2 ตัว และลบ linked-table ที่มี แล้วค่อยลิงค์เข้ามาใหม่อีกที
    
  ให้ลอง Compact and Repair Database ถ้าคุณแยกไฟล์โปรแกรมและฐานข้อมูลออกจากกัน ก็ให้ทำทั้ง 2 ตัว และลบ linked-table ที่มี แล้วค่อยลิงค์เข้ามาใหม่อีกที
      Time: 0.5068s
    
      
		